Construction Workers Critically Injured in Ljubljana Accident
Two construction workers are in mortal danger following an accident on Kranjčeva Street in Ljubljana. The incident involved falling armature plates, which are believed to have caused severe injuries to the workers. Emergency services were dispatched to the scene following the collapse. The condition of the injured individuals is critical, and they have been transported for urgent medical attention. Further details regarding the cause of the accident and the specific nature of the injuries are still emerging. Investigations into the incident are expected to commence to determine the circumstances surrounding the collapse of the armature plates.
